【摘要】 本文以吴国青铜兵器的金相检测为基础,利用电子显微镜对样品中出现的纯铜晶粒进行检 测分析,从矿物转化及自然铜形成机理解释了纯铜晶粒的形成,讨论了可能形成纯铜晶粒的条件。 结果认为纯铜晶粒的析出并非是筒单的电解分解与电解析出,这个过程涉及到合金的矿化产生不 稳定的中间腐蚀产物向析出自然铜的稳定态转变,这种转化由原子在矿物质中的反应扩散完成。这 个过程相当漫长,非实验室条件所能摸拟。从矿物转化析出机理考虑,纯铜晶粒中的“李晶”结构可 解释为自然铜的双晶形态,与合金本身,加工工艺以及腐蚀产生的微小体积变化无关。

【Abstract】 Free copper is a common microstructural constituent of the most samples of Wu State bronzes. The bronzes dated to late Western Zhou, Spring & Autumn and Warring States period have undergone corrosion over a long period in the environnent of soil. Diverse morphologies of the free copper have been recorded. A: Globular particles: respectively presents in single lead particle, eutectoid phase and the structure. B: Filament of free copper: includes netform and curve form, respectively presents in interdendritic boundary, eutectoid phase, and crack produced by corrosion or substance berween mineralized surface layer and underlying metallic substrate. C: Polycrystal band of free copper respectively presents in crack of intermetal structure, and crack between oxided bonder layer and metallic body. Regions of re -- deposited copper are usually coarse grained and often contain twin related crystals. This paper is based on investigation of bronze samples of Wu State weapons by metallographic and SEM method. Studies on the re - deposition Of copper indecated that re -- deposition of free copper is not a simple electroresolve and electrodeposition process. It is related to mineralization took palce in the structure. There are some changes in the structure sorrounding free copper grain, including changes in microstructure and concentration of element. The development of polycrystal band of free copper has been observed. This paper tried to interpret re -- deposition of copper with mineral transfoming mechanism of alloy during corrosion. The re -- deposition of free copper involves that middle stage corrosion producs produced by mineralization of alloy can transform into stable state because of deposition of free copper. The transforming is accomplished by react diffuse of atom in substance. This process is very long, and involves many factors which include componend of alloy, working technique, surroundings of bronzes in the earth and so on. The characteristics and the conditions of formation of the free copper are sufficiently peculiar that they are difficult to reproduce in accelerated laboratory simulations. The twin structure is equal to twin form of natural copper. It is not related to alloy itself, working technique, and tiny strain change in crystal.
